A VDR is a cloud-based solution that lets multiple users securely share and manage sensitive data. It provides many benefits for businesses like efficient collaboration, comfortable access to papers read here and improved due diligence processes. Additionally, it allows companies to avoid the cost of actually shipping or perhaps storing paperwork and minimizes the chance of accidental reduction or fraud. The most important component to consider when choosing a online vdr is it is security features. Look for watermarking, 256-bit encryption and multifactor authentication to protect against hackers. It should also have a integrated activity system and file-level digital rights operations to prevent info from currently being printed or downloaded.
M&A orders require a great deal of data to become shared between parties, and there’s quite often no time to spare. VDRs can help speed up the process by causing it simpler for stakeholders to get into and review files, with granular accord and activity tracking thus everyone knows that has doing what and when.
